body {
	margin-top: 0px;
	background-color:#1D1D1D;
	text-align: center; /* pour corriger le bug de centrage IE */
		background-image:url(../image/noelfond.jpg);
	background-repeat:no-repeat;
	background-position:center;
	background-position:top;
}
#conten
{
width: 780px;
margin-left: auto;
margin-right: auto;
text-align: center; /* pour corriger le bug de centrage IE */
}
#contenover
{
width: 780px;
text-align: center; /* pour corriger le bug de centrage IE */
margin-left: auto;
margin-right: auto;
background-image: url(../image/bas.jpg);
background-repeat: no-repeat;
height:130px;
}
.headersite{
	background-image: url(../image/entetepart.jpg);
	background-repeat: no-repeat;
	background-position: top center;
	width: 780px;
	height: 200px;
	}
.placelogin {
	margin-left: 30px;
	text-align: left;
	padding-bottom: 3px;
    margin-top:0px;

} 
.placeheader {
	text-align: center;
	padding-top: 0px;
    height: 110px;
	width: 742px;
} 

.placepubas {
	margin-right: 80px;
	text-align: right;
	padding-bottom: 3px;
} 
.placebastext {
	text-align: center;
	padding-bottom: 15px;
	margin-left: 120px;

} 
.menu_left {
	margin-top: 35px;
	margin-left: 18px;
	text-align:left;
	}
.menu_left_fin {
	margin-top: 3px;
	}

#bloc_livredor a.erreur  {  font-size: 13px; color: #000000; font-weight: bold; background: #B8B876 }
#bloc_livredor a.titre   {  font-size: 13px; color: #FFFFFF; font-weight: bold; background: #FF7E00 }
#bloc_livredor a.ok      {  font-size: 13px; color: #1C2D67; font-weight: bold; background: #FDF9AA }
#bloc_livredor a.heure   {  font-size: 13px; color: #FFFFFF; font-weight: bold; background: #FF7E00 }
#bloc_livredor a.date {  font-size: 13px; color: #0540FD; font-weight: bold; text-decoration: none }

#bloc_livredor a.signer         { font-size: 13px; color: #FFFF00 }
#bloc_livredor a.signer:link    { font-size: 13px; color: #0078FF; font-weight: normal; text-decoration: none }
#bloc_livredor a.signer:visited { font-size: 13px; color: #0078FF; font-weight: normal; text-decoration: none }
#bloc_livredor a.signer:hover   { font-size: 13px; color: #FFFF00; font-weight: normal; text-decoration: underline }

#bloc_livredor a.email         { color: #F99E44; font-weight: bold; text-decoration: none }
#bloc_livredor a.email:link    { color: #F99E44; font-weight: bold; text-decoration: none }
#bloc_livredor a.email:visited { color: #F99E44; font-weight: bold; text-decoration: none }
#bloc_livredor a.email:hover   { color: #F99E44; font-weight: bold; text-decoration: underline }

.cadrepart {
width:500px;
padding:4px;
background-color:#A2C3DA;
font-weight:bold;
}
.textpart {width:500px;padding:4px;text-align:left;}
.textpart a.textpart { font-family:  Verdana; font-size: 12px; color: #000000; font-weight: bold;}
.textpart a.textpart:link { font-family:  Verdana; font-size: 12px; color: #000000; text-decoration: none; font-weight: bold;}
.textpart a.textpart:visited { font-family:  Verdana; font-size: 12px; color: #000000;  text-decoration: none; font-weight: bold;}
.textpart a.textpart:hover { font-family:  Verdana; font-size: 12px; color: #000000; text-decoration: underline; font-weight: bold;}
